Brushwork and Application Techniques
Different tools change how Michaels FolkArt paint looks on the surface. A flat brush delivers smooth, even coverage, while a sponge adds textured, painterly effects. For fine lines and detailed patterns, use a small liner or brush lettering brush.
Thin the paint slightly with water for better flow in detailed areas, and apply multiple thin coats instead of one heavy layer to reduce drying time and minimize brush marks.
Surface Preparation and Priming
Preparing the surface improves adhesion and color vibrancy. Clean dust and grease from wood, plastic, or metal, then lightly sand glossy finishes for better grip.
Use a primer or gesso when moving from a dark background to light colors, or when working on porous surfaces that might absorb moisture unevenly. A well-prepped surface keeps the paint film strong and durable.
Finishing and Sealing Options
Sealing protects the painted surface from moisture, handling, and UV exposure. Choose a finish that matches the item’s use, such as matte for decor pieces and satin or gloss for items that need easy cleaning.
Apply sealant in thin, even coats once the paint is fully dry. Stir gently to avoid bubbles, and allow each layer to cure according to the manufacturer’s instructions for best results.

Can I use Michaels FolkArt paint on outdoor projects?
Yes, after sealing with a weather-resistant polyurethane or outdoor topcoat, FolkArt paint can hold up on outdoor décor, planters, and furniture.
Do I need to seal FolkArt paint on items used for food or drink?
Use only food-safe, waterproof sealers designed for surfaces that contact food, and always ensure full curing before use to maintain safety and durability.
